By TRN Online, Kathmandu, Apr. 24: Deputy Prime Minister and Home
Minister Narayan Kaji Shrestha has stressed promoting insurance at the grass roots
to manage disaster risk mitigation.
He said so while speaking at a
national workshop on 'disaster risk management policies and practices:
opportunities and challenges for development resilience'.
The DPM also pointed at the
need to mobilise disaster risk fund to disaster mitigation, not only limiting
it to relief distribution.
DPM Shrestha urged the local
levels to get mobilized on long-term works including identification of open
space for the time of disaster and development of necessary infrastructure.
He viewed that there was need
of effective implementation and monitoring of the national strategic action
plan on disaster risk mitigation. He also pointed at the need to unify works
related to preparedness and risk mitigation.
DPM Shrestha held that disaster
risk management work could be accomplished effectively only through efficient
coordination among all the three tiers of the government and the other stakeholders.
